#d1cd12 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1cd12 is composed of 82% red, 80.4%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.9% magenta, 91.4%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 58.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 44.5%. #d1cd12 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ff24 with #a39b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#d1cd12 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1cd12 has RGB values of R:209, G:205,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.91,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13749522.

Shades and Tints of #d1cd12
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0a01 is the darkest color, while #fefef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1cd12
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7969 is the less saturated color, while #e2de01 is the most saturated one.
